Least Common Multiple of 22778 and 22789 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 22778 and 22789,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(22778,22789) = 1
LCM(22778,22789) = ( 22778 × 22789) / 1
LCM(22778,22789) = 519087842 / 1
LCM(22778,22789) = 519087842
